>> Although I haven't looked in complete detail in each of the AG Dojo
>> pieces, i know that the 0.4.3 transition to 1.1.1 will take some work
>> because the widget system has been separated out to it's own pieces (diji)
>> and so simple work arounds will not do. That is, this will be a big block
>> change rather than an incremental one.
